What is key to achieving a professional polish application?

Achieving a professional polish application hinges significantly on proper base preparation. This step ensures that the nail surface is clean, smooth, and free of any oils or debris that could affect adhesion and the overall finish of the polish. Properly preparing the nails involves techniques such as filing, buffing, and applying a suitable base coat to create an ideal canvas for the polish to adhere to. When the base is well prepared, it enhances the longevity of the manicure or pedicure and improves the aesthetic quality of the polished nails, giving a more professional appearance.

In contrast, while bright colored polish can make a statement, it does not directly influence the quality of the application. Frequent touch-ups may be necessary for maintenance but do not contribute to the initial professional finish. Lastly, using thicker polish layers can lead to uneven drying and a bulky look, which detracts from the polished effect. Therefore, proper base preparation stands out as the critical factor in achieving a polished and professional look.
